6. Welsh in Popular Culture

The Welsh language has influenced various cultural aspects, notably music, poetry, and literature. Legendary singers like Tom Jones and Shirley Bassey have roots in Welsh, and many poets, such as Dylan Thomas, have embraced the language through their works. Additionally, Welsh-language television and films, like S4C's offerings, contribute to its visibility and popularity.
